Abstract
We have demonstrated efficiencies approaching 100% for the translation (upward or downward) of a 10.6 μm laser beam by .31, .53 and 1.16 cm-1 using the linear electro-optic effect in CdTe. Equations are given for extrapolation of these results to other laser wavelengths and other amounts of shift.
